Bonjour j’aimerais avoir les droits d’accès « root »pour pouvoir changer un logiciel dans /opt
Savez-vous comment?
Droit d’acc Root Raspberry Pi [RESOLU]
Modérateurs : Francois, maxty01
-
- Messages : 1
- Enregistré le : dim. 8 sept. 2019 20:13
Re: Droit d’acc Root Raspberry Pi
Bonjour :
Par défaut (debian aime bien la sécurité) : l'accès en root est désactivé.
Cependant, on peut lancer toute commande en demandant les droits de root en la préfixant par sudo
Ex :
et bien
Tu peux aussi une fois connecté en pi, faire
Ensuite, si tu veux vraiment pouvoir te logger en root : (certains diront "oh non !" mais oui, il y a des fois où on en a besoin)
Il faut déjà activer le compte root en lui donnant un mot de passe :
Donc une fois connecté avec le user pi fait ceci :
Là, tu pourras te logger directement en root sur ton raspi
Mais toujours pas en ssh via le réseau !
Pour ça, il faut encore faire une manip :
modifier le fichier de config de sshd
De mémoire :
Tu y trouveras une ligne avec un # devant
En dessous, mets
Et soit tu reboot le pi, soit tu relances le service ssh
Là, tu pourras te connecter avec winscp de ton PC sous windows à ton Raspi directement en root.
Attention à ne pas supprimer n'importe quel fichier ou dossier ! (une boulette est vite arrivée)
Facile non ?
Par défaut (debian aime bien la sécurité) : l'accès en root est désactivé.
Cependant, on peut lancer toute commande en demandant les droits de root en la préfixant par sudo
Ex :
t'est refusé parce que pi n'a pas les droits d'écritures dans /opt ?cp /home/pi/toto.txt /opt/toto.txt
et bien
va fonctionner.sudo cp /home/pi/toto.txt /opt/toto.txt
Tu peux aussi une fois connecté en pi, faire
: tu te retrouveras loggé en tant que root dans une session de pi.sudo su
Ensuite, si tu veux vraiment pouvoir te logger en root : (certains diront "oh non !" mais oui, il y a des fois où on en a besoin)
Il faut déjà activer le compte root en lui donnant un mot de passe :
Donc une fois connecté avec le user pi fait ceci :
sudo su
On te demandera un mot de passe pour le compte root puis de le confirmer.passwd
Là, tu pourras te logger directement en root sur ton raspi
Mais toujours pas en ssh via le réseau !
Pour ça, il faut encore faire une manip :
modifier le fichier de config de sshd
De mémoire :
Tu cherches (CTRL+W) PermitRootLoginsudo nano /etc/ssh/sshd_config
Tu y trouveras une ligne avec un # devant
En dessous, mets
Puis tu quittes en sauvegardant (CTRL+O pour enregistrer, CTRL+X pour quitter)PermitRootLogin yes
Et soit tu reboot le pi, soit tu relances le service ssh
Si tu n'as pas d'erreur, c'est que c'est tout bon, sinon, c'est que tu as fait une faute de frappe dans le fichier sshd_config.sudo systemctl restart ssh
Là, tu pourras te connecter avec winscp de ton PC sous windows à ton Raspi directement en root.
Attention à ne pas supprimer n'importe quel fichier ou dossier ! (une boulette est vite arrivée)
Facile non ?
Modifié en dernier par cbalo le jeu. 12 sept. 2019 09:58, modifié 1 fois.
-
- Administrateur
- Messages : 3234
- Enregistré le : mer. 17 sept. 2014 18:12
- Localisation : Seine et Marne
Re: Droit d’acc Root Raspberry Pi
Bonjour,
Petite astuce pour passer root depuis un compte utilisateur autorisé à utiliser "sudo".
Il suffit de lancer
Et voila, vous êtes "root"
Petite astuce pour passer root depuis un compte utilisateur autorisé à utiliser "sudo".
Il suffit de lancer
Code : Tout sélectionner
sudo -i
Passionné de Raspberry, Arduino, ESP8266, ESP32, et objets connectés :
Spécial débutant, concevez vous-même votre domotique DIY : https://www.youtube.com/c/DomoticDIY
Conception d'une station météo DIY, et envoi des infos à votre Domotique.
Spécial débutant, concevez vous-même votre domotique DIY : https://www.youtube.com/c/DomoticDIY
Conception d'une station météo DIY, et envoi des infos à votre Domotique.
-
- Raspinaute
- Messages : 248
- Enregistré le : mar. 7 oct. 2014 09:46
- Localisation : Morsang / Orge - Essonne
- Contact :
Re: Droit d’acc Root Raspberry Pi
Bonjour,
on ne peux pas utiliser "sudo -i" quand on utilise WINSCP. J' ai résolu le probléme en créant des clefs en suivant ce tuto https://www.nas-forum.com/forum/topic/5 ... 1319333000
puis en ssh dans putty dans le répertoire user.
et coller la clef générée dans puttgen (RSA 2048)
ensuite
et coller la clef générée dans puttgen (RSA 2048)
Code : Tout sélectionner
puis en ssh dans putty dans le répertoire user.
Code : Tout sélectionner
mkdir .ssh
nano .ssh/authorized_keys
ensuite
Code : Tout sélectionner
sudo mkdir /root/.ssh
sudo nano /root/.ssh/authorized_keys
DS712+ 2x Western Digital WD10EADS-00L 1000 GB (SHR) - Firmware: DSM 6.1.6-15266
Raspberry - RFXTRX433 - Aeon Labs ZStick V2 - Domoticz
FreeBox v6
https://meteo.folcke.net
https://wiki.folcke.net
Raspberry - RFXTRX433 - Aeon Labs ZStick V2 - Domoticz
FreeBox v6
https://meteo.folcke.net
https://wiki.folcke.net